11. Provide any additional information regarding application (how it was applied, amount applied, the size of the area treated etc).
Caller stated that his neighbour sprayed pesticides and affected his apple orchard. The caller has a weather station and the winds at the time of spraying were between 15 to 20 km/h. He said there is spray drift about 800 feet into his farm. The spraying occurred May 14, 2013.

7. Describe symptoms and outcome (died, recovered, etc.).
Caller states there was quite a bit of damage to his orchard. The farmer sprayed Touchdown, Primextra and Calisto. He aid the trees closest to the gap in the tree row were hit the hardest. XXXXX said the corn field was sprayed on May 14th and he started seeing some spots on Sunday May 19 then more after that.
